Glass Replacement

There are instances where replacing glass on a window is simply the best alternative. This could be the case when the window itself is damaged beyond repair, or when there is extensive rot and damage to the frame which makes it unable to perform as it ought to. The good part is that replacing the glass in your double-glazed windows doesn't have to be costly or difficult. In fact, a lot of homeowners find that retaining the frame they have in place while upgrading to more energy efficient or attractive glass units is cheaper than replacing them with a brand new window.

Double glazing owners frequently report that their doors and windows are difficult to open or close. This is usually because of a damaged latch or other hardware. It can be fixed by cooling it down and then lubricating it.

Another issue that is commonly encountered and can be addressed by a professional is the accumulation of condensation between window panes. This can cause moisture to leak into the room, leading to damp and mold, and is a serious health risk, as well as degrading the window's ability to keep the home warm.

A professional will be able to clean and eliminate any moisture that has built up between the window panes, thereby leaving your double glazing looking clear again. They can also replace the seals that are between the upvc window repairs near me panes in order to restore the functionality of the windows and properly to insulate your home.

The cost of replacing all the glass on windows with larger dimensions, such as bow and bay windows that have multiple angled panes will be more expensive. However, the average costs of repairing one blown window is PS100 or less, which is significantly cheaper than the cost of purchasing and installing an entire replacement window unit. Restoring your windows' insulation back to their original condition will make them more energy-efficient and will save you money on your utility bills. Misted Panes

Double-glazed windows are a great addition to any home. They are extremely insulating however, moisture can build up between the glass panes. If not taken care of, this can result in a myriad of problems in your home including dampness, mildew and mould growth as well as increased costs for utilities. This is particularly true in older properties that were not equipped with double glazing to a high standard.

Professionals can swiftly and easily repair misted windows. The process involves removing the damaged glass and blowing hot air through the gap in order to dry out any moisture. A new seal is then applied to the window, and it will be functional again.

In certain cases a professional will be able to perform a resealing procedure that can keep the issue from happening in future. This technique can be used to repair single-pane windows which have developed a problem due to condensation, and not leaks.

Drilling a hole in the window and then inserting a desiccant packet inside is a common way to repair a misty glass. However, this is an ineffective long-term solution since at the very least, it could cause damage to the window and at best it will allow dust, moisture and dirt to pass through it.

If the problem is identified it is suggested homeowners call a professional window repair service. This will ensure that any issues are resolved as quickly as possible before they grow into a larger issue like mould or damp.

The moisture in your double-glazed windows could trigger asthma, respiratory infections, and other health problems. So, fixing a leaky window early on is essential to prevent damage to your home and enhance the comfort of your family. This is especially crucial in the winter months when excessive moisture leads to cold homes and higher energy bills.
